More thoughts on this entire process from the outside, this time Boston.

The dedicated Kings fans, the younger core of players, and Cousins deserve better than what management has offered so far. And Corbin deserved better than coaching the past few weeks, knowing full well D’Alessandro and owner Vivek Ranadive were not going to keep their promise of retaining him for the season.

Now the 16-year NBA veteran and one of the league’s real gentlemen is out of work. So Corbin will be paid the remaining money on his contract for the rest of the season — at least the Kings will do that — before searching for a new coaching position this summer.

The coaching business is cut-throat and there are protocols of respect to follow; openly campaigning for jobs that are filled, and publicly negotiating with another candidate while your current coach is attempting to win games and maintain organizational sanity is deplorable.

Corbin deserved better, and hopefully D’Alessandro and Ranadive learn from their mistakes. If not, the Kings will remain, well, the Kings.
